Here’s everything you’ll need for this strawberry mango smoothie recipe, plus what each ingredient brings to the blend:

  • ½ cup mango – Adds chunks of sweet mango and tropical flavor that forms the smoothie’s base
  • ½ cup pineapple – Brightens the smoothie with natural acidity and balances sweetness
  • ½ banana – Creates a creamy texture and helps thicken the smoothie naturally
  • 5 whole strawberries – Fresh strawberries bring vibrant color, flavor, and vitamin C
  • ¼ cup orange juice – Adds citrus brightness and helps blend everything smoothly
  • 1 tablespoon flaxseed – Adds healthy fats, fiber, and boosts daily values
  • Ice cubes – Keeps the smoothie cold and gives it that thick smoothie consistency

This mango strawberry smoothie comes together in just two simple steps:

Step 1 photo of strawberry mango smoothie ingredients being added to a blender

STEP 1: Add ingredients to a blender – Place mango, pineapple, banana, strawberries, orange juice, flax seeds, and ice cubes into a high-speed blender.

STEP 2: Blend until smooth and creamy – Blend until fully combined and silky smooth. Add a splash of water or fruit juice if needed to help everything blend. Pour into a glass, serve immediately, and enjoy your perfect smoothie. Enjoy!


Strawberry Mango Smoothie Substitutions

Want to switch things up? This smoothie is super flexible and is great base for other variations. Below are a few for inspiration:

  • Swap orange juice for unsweetened almond milk, soy milk, coconut water, or unsweetened coconut milk
  • Use frozen fruit instead of fresh for a thicker smoothie
  • Add chia seeds, hemp hearts, or protein powder for extra protein
  • Blend in spinach to turn it into a spinach smoothie or green smoothie
  • Turn it into a strawberry mango smoothie bowl by using less liquid and topping with fresh fruit

  • Use ripe bananas for the best natural sweetness
  • Frozen fruit creates a thicker smoothie without watering it down
  • Start with less liquid and add a little bit at a time
  • A high-speed blender gives the creamiest texture
  • If you like ultra-smooth blends, blend longer than you think

  • You can store the entire smoothie or leftover smoothie in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Afterwards, simply shake or re-blend before drinking.
  • This smoothie makes an amazing popsicle! Freeze leftovers into popsicle molds for a refreshing snack on a hot day.
